13th: ended slavery in the united states
14th: extended protection under the law to all u.s citizens
15th: extended the right to vote to African american males.
19th: extended the right to vote for women

During the brutal 4 year rule of the Khmer Rouge they were responsible for the deaths of approximately a quarter of the Cambodian people.
The Vietnamese invasion of Cambodia ended the genocide by defeating the Khmer Rouge in January 1979.
